Everything about Student Accommodation near London College of Fashion (LCF)

The early origins of the London College of Fashion exist in three trade schools, all of which were for women: the Shoreditch Technical Institute Girls School which was founded in 1906; the Barrett Street Trade School which was founded in 1915; and the Clapham Trade School which was founded in 1927. With big names from the fashion industry like Jimmy Choo, William Tempest, amongst others being a part of their alumni, it is no wonder those aspiring to make it big choose to study here.

Courses Offered in London College of Fashion

LCF is a member college of the University of the Arts London, inviting students from all over the world. The college offers a range of short-term and long-term courses – from business to photography to design. Also, London College of Fashion offers students three Integrated Masters degree courses that are an innovative and flexible way to achieve your postgraduate goal. The main campus is located just north of Oxford Circus, on John Prince’s Street whereas other campuses are located at 40 Lime Grove in Shepherd's Bush as well as in East London at 100 Curtain Road (Old Street).

The history behind British fashion

The fashion scene in London has a fascinating history behind it, inspired by the style of the upper class and English royalty along with a mix of street style. During the 19th century, Victorian fashion was modernised for both sexes, earning a reputation for being high-end. It wasn’t till the 20th century that the British fashion industry began to experiment with their style, taking on a more modern approach.

Transportation in and around London

London city has an extensive public transport network which includes private as well as public services – buses, river and road systems spanning all of the city's 32 boroughs. For someone who is new to the city, a tour on the double decker buses is a delight. The city is also well-connected via the Tube, which is the Underground rail network and is one of the best ways to explore London. For a picturesque view of the city – Greenwich and East London, take a ride in the cable car.
